Payson pricing

AC repair cost by part.

Typical Payson repair pricing including parts and labor. A diagnostic fee usually applies and is often credited toward the work.

AC repair in Payson, Utah typically costs between $125 and $2,500+, depending on the issue. With a median home age of 34 years, many systems are due for repairs like capacitor or blower motor replacements. Utah requires a mechanical permit for AC work, and local techs are familiar with the cold-dry high-desert climate. Most homes use gas furnaces paired with central AC, so repairs often focus on the cooling side. Diagnostic fees run $65–$175, and labor rates reflect the area's moderate cost of living.

What Payson code requires

Installing or replacing an HVAC system in Payson follows Utah rules under the state mechanical code. Here’s what applies statewide:

  • Permit

    Mechanical permit pulled by your licensed HVAC contractor; covers equipment, refrigerant, and the electrical disconnect.

    Required
  • SEER2 minimum

    Federal North-region minimum for new split-system AC. Higher tiers cut bills and unlock rebates.

    13.4 SEER2 (North)
  • Load calculation

    Sizing by load calc — not rule of thumb — prevents an oversized unit that short-cycles and never dehumidifies.

    Recommended
  • Refrigerant
    R-454B / R-32 (R-410A phased down 2025+)
  • Good to know

    Cold-dry high-desert climate: equipment should be sized for hard winter heating loads, and a cold-climate (NEEP-listed) heat pump is required to earn the top Rocky Mountain Power Wattsmart rebate.

AC Repair in Payson, explained.

What moves the price

What affects AC repair costs in Payson?

The type of part needed drives the price: a capacitor replacement runs $125–$350, while a compressor can cost $1,050–$2,500+. Older systems (median home built 1992) may need more labor due to wear. The cold-dry climate means equipment must handle both summer cooling and winter heating, so repairs on heat pumps or dual-fuel setups can be more involved. Permit fees and refrigerant type (R-454B or R-32 for newer systems) also add to the total.

Common AC repairs in Payson

1

Capacitor or contactor failure

These parts often fail in older units, causing the AC to not start or cycle poorly. Replacement costs $125–$350.

2

Refrigerant leak or low charge

Leaks are common in aging systems, requiring recharge ($225–$650+) and repair. Newer units use R-454B or R-32.

3

Fan or blower motor issues

A faulty motor can reduce airflow. Replacement runs $300–$800, often needed in homes with dusty conditions.
